This is my question as well. What power does a Governor have in a case like this? What is he going to do, send in the Florida State Police to interfere with the Feds? Or, is Mr DeSantis just posturing for the rubes?
This case isn’t the Feds, though. It’s New York. Specifically, Manhattan. They will need cooperation from Florida law enforcement to facilitate an arrest in Florida.
The question is to what extent DeSantis is willing to violate the Constitution in these matters. I don’t know how tight his control is over Florida law enforcement.
